Summary of Bill HR 9258
Bill 117 hr 9258, also known as the "Medicare Off-Campus Facility Access Act," aims to change regulations within the Medicare program that currently require off-campus facilities or organizations to be located within a 35-mile radius of a hospital or critical access hospital. The bill directs the Secretary of Health and Human Services to revise these regulations, allowing for greater flexibility in the location of off-campus facilities.
The purpose of this bill is to expand access to healthcare services for Medicare beneficiaries by removing the geographic restrictions that currently limit where off-campus facilities can be located. By eliminating the 35-mile radius requirement, more off-campus facilities will be able to provide care to patients, particularly in underserved or rural areas where access to healthcare services may be limited.
Overall, the goal of Bill 117 hr 9258 is to improve access to healthcare for Medicare beneficiaries by allowing off-campus facilities to be located in a wider range of locations, ultimately increasing the availability of care for those who need it most.

Congressional Summary of HR 9258
Rural ER Access Act
This bill requires the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services to repeal regulations that require off-campus facilities to be located within 35 miles of the main hospital or critical access hospital in order to receive provider-based status under Medicare (i.e., to be considered as hospital outpatient departments for purposes of Medicare payment).

Current Status of Bill HR 9258
Bill HR 9258 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since October 31, 2022. Bill HR 9258 was introduced during Congress 117 and was introduced to the House on October 31, 2022. Bill HR 9258's most recent activity was Referred to the Subcommittee on Health. as of November 1, 2022
